How Long Are Chicken Fajitas Good For?

Chicken fajitas are delicious, easy to cook, and available in many restaurants. However, they do have a short shelf life, especially if not stored properly.

Chicken fajitas can last for 3-4 days in the refrigerator. To store them correctly, place them in an airtight container or wrap them t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il. This will help prevent bacteria from growing and causing them to spoil.

Chicken fajitas can also be frozen for up to 2-3 months. Just place them in a freezer-safe container or wrap them t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il. When you’re ready to eat them, thaw them in the refrigerator overnight and heat them thoroughly before eating.

It’s important to note that the temperature at which your fridge and freezer are kept can affect how long chicken fajitas will last. The FoodSafety.gov website recommends that your fridge be set at or below 40 degrees Fahrenheit and your freezer be set at or below 0 degrees Fahrenheit. This will help ensure that your food stays fresh and safe to eat for as long as possible.

Overall, chicken fajitas are best eaten within 3-4 days of making them. If you want to store them for longer, freezing is a good option. Just make sure to keep them in an airtight container or wrap them t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il to keep them fresh.

Can You Freeze Chicken Fajitas, And If So, How Long Will They Last In The Freezer?

Freezing chicken fajitas is a great way to preserve them and enjoy them at a later date. Chicken fajitas can be frozen for up to 3 months. To freeze them, first allow them to cool completely. Then, wrap them in plastic wrap or aluminum foil and place them in a resealable freezer bag. Alternatively, you can freeze them in individual portions for easy thawing and reheating. To thaw frozen chicken fajitas, remove them from the freezer and place them in the refrigerator overnight. You can then reheat them in the oven, on the stovetop, or in the microwave.

Are There Any Specific Precautions You Should Take When Reheating Chicken Fajitas?

Reheating chicken fajitas is a simple process, but there are a few things you should keep in mind to ensure the chicken remains moist and flavorful. Here are a few tips:

1. Use the oven: Preheat your o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it. Place the fajitas in an oven-safe dish and cover with foil. Bake for 10-15 minutes, or until heated through.

2. Use a skillet: Heat a skillet over medium-high heat. Add the fajitas and cook for 2-3 minutes on each side, or until heated through.

3. Use a microwave: Place the fajitas on a microwave-safe plate and cover with a damp paper towel. Microwave on high for 1-2 minutes, or until heated through.

No matter which method you choose, it’s important to let the chicken rest for a few minutes before serving. This will allow the juices to redistribute, making the chicken more moist and flavorful.

It’s also important to use caution when reheating chicken. Make sure the chicken is cooked all the way through, and use a food thermometer to ensure it reaches an internal temperature of 165 degrees Fahrenheit.
